Many factors influence the market for DG, including government policies at the local, state, and federal levels, and project costs, which vary significantly depending on location, size, and application. Current and future DG equipment costs are subject to uncertainty.. Distributed generation (DG) in the residential and commercial buildings sectors and in the industrial sector refers to onsite, behind-the-meter energy generation. DG often includes electricity from renewable energy systems such as solar photovoltaics (PV) and small wind turbines, as well as battery. . For solar-plus-storage—the pairing of solar photovoltaic (PV) and energy storage technologies—NLR researchers study and quantify the economic and grid impacts of distributed and utility-scale systems. Much of NLR's current energy storage research is informing solar-plus-storage analysis. Energy. . Battery storage attachment rates continue inching upwards. In 2023, 12% of all new residential PV installations and 8% of all non-residential installations included battery storage. As part of our Annual Energy. [PDF Version]

Why is distributed energy storage important?

Dispatchable distributed energy storage can be used for grid control, reliability, and resiliency, thereby creating additional value for the consumer. Unlike distributed generation, the value of distributed storage is in control of the dimensions of capacity, voltage, frequency, and phase angle.

Why is distributed energy storage important in renewable microgrids?

In such cases, a distributed energy storage (DES) can play an essential role in improving stability, strengthening reliability, and ensuring security. This monograph is dedicated to fundamentals and applications of energy storage in renewable microgrids.

What is distributed energy storage method?

Distributed energy storage method plays a major role in preventing power fluctuation and power quality problems caused by these systems in the grid. The main point of application is dimensioning the energy storage system and positioning it in the distribution grid.
